Vegetarian pizza

Vegetarian pizza recipe is very easy and fun to make, an interesting view would make the children happy and want to try a delicious vegetarian pizza. It is suitable for children who do not like vegetables


Ingredients:
  • 4 whole wheat pita
  • 1/2 cup vegan pesto
  • 1 medium onion
  • 1 red bell pepper, thin slices
  • 1 tomato, sliced wedges
  • 1 garlic clove, minced
  • 3 Tbs. kalamata olives, sliced
  • 3 Tbs. Marinated Artichoke Hearts, chopped
  • 2 Tbs. olive oil
  • 1/4 tsp. oregano 
  • 1/4 tsp. basil 
  • 2 Tbs, sesame seeds, toasted 


Preparation:
  1. Preheat oven to 300 ° F, or use a toaster oven.
  2. Mince the onion and saute with olive oil on low heat. Slice the pepper and add to onions, saute for 5 minutes.
  3. Place the 4 pitas on a baking tray. Place in the oven for 3 minutes to slightly cook the crust of the pita and give it a light crispy texture. Remove and set aside to cool while you slice the toppings.
  4. Spread the basil on the top of each pita. Add the olives, artichoke hearts, onions, tomato slices and peppers. Sprinkle the toasted sesame seeds over the top.
  5. Cook in the oven for 5 minutes.
Serve warm and enjoy!
